Let’s start with the star ingredient of this dish – rice noodles. Rice noodles are a versatile ingredient that is commonly used in Asian cuisine. They are light, gluten-free, and cook quickly, making them perfect for salads. In this recipe, we will be using vermicelli rice noodles, but you can use any type of rice noodles you prefer.
Next up, we have the chicken. Chicken is a lean source of protein that pairs beautifully with the flavors of the fresh herbs and tangy dressing. We will be using boneless, skinless chicken breasts for this recipe, but feel free to use chicken thighs if you prefer.
Now, let’s talk about the fresh herbs. Fresh herbs are the secret to taking this dish to the next level. We will be using a combination of cilantro, mint, and Thai basil. These herbs add a pop of freshness and brightness to the dish that complements the savory chicken and tangy dressing perfectly.
And finally, the tangy dressing. The dressing for this salad is a combination of fish sauce, lime juice, sugar, and garlic. It is tangy, slightly sweet, and full of umami flavor. The dressing ties all the flavors of the dish together and adds a refreshing kick that will keep you coming back for more.
To make this Rice Noodle Salad with Chicken, Fresh Herbs, and Tangy Dressing, start by cooking the rice noodles according to the package instructions. While the noodles are cooking, season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per and grill them until they are cooked through. Let the chicken rest for a few minutes before slicing it into thin strips.
In a large bowl, combine the cooked rice noodles, sliced chicken, fresh herbs, and tangy dressing. Toss everything together until it is evenly coated in the dressing. Divide the salad into serving bowls and garnish with chopped peanuts and a wedge of lime.
